How can I prepare my home's electrical system for an ice storm or a summer brownout?

For winter ice storms, ensure your generator has a proper transfer switch installed to prevent backfeed. In summer, brownouts from high AC demand can damage motors in appliances like refrigerators. A service upgrade to 200A provides headroom, and a whole-house surge protector defends against the voltage spikes that often occur when grid power restores after an outage.

My smart devices keep resetting after storms. Is this a Duke Energy grid problem or my wiring?

Madeira experiences moderate surge risk from seasonal thunderstorms. While Duke Energy's grid can have fluctuations, the primary defense is inside your home. Old wiring and undersized panels offer poor protection. Installing whole-house surge protection at your service entrance is critical to safeguard sensitive electronics from both utility-side and atmospheric surges.

I'm worried about my Federal Pacific panel and want to add an EV charger. Can my system handle it?

A Federal Pacific panel is a known fire hazard and should be replaced immediately. Even if it weren't, your 100A service lacks the capacity for a Level 2 EV charger or a modern heat pump. Upgrading to a 200A service with a new, code-compliant panel is a mandatory first step for both safety and functionality.

My power comes from an overhead line to a mast on my roof. Is that setup outdated?

Overhead mast service is standard for homes of your vintage in this area. The concern isn't the mast itself, but the aging service entrance cables and weatherhead that connect it to Duke Energy's lines. These components degrade over decades and are a common point of failure during high winds or ice loading, often requiring a full service mast replacement.

We have a lot of big trees near City Hall. Could that be affecting my home's power quality?

Yes. Camargo's heavy tree canopy can cause issues. Branches contacting overhead service lines create interference and intermittent faults. Furthermore, tree root systems in our soil can disrupt grounding electrode conductors, compromising your home's entire safety system. An inspection should verify your grounding integrity.
